The video tutorial explains the process of crystallization by dissolving borax in boiling water and observing crystal formation on pipe cleaners. It covers the materials needed, the preparation of the solution, and the scientific principles behind crystallization. The tutorial emphasizes the importance of monitoring the process and provides a clear explanation of how crystals form as the solution cools. The video concludes with a summary and suggestions for further reading.
